Here, flashing beacon light circuit give many useful use, like distress signal on highway or direction guide in different places like parking area, hospitals and hotels.

In this presentation, we also introduce flashing beacon design using well known LM317 regulator IC.

LM317 regulator can give more than 1 ampere and powers a small good quality 12V, 10W bulb with effective reflector for clear and easy visibility.

For operation, connect 12 to 15V, 1 ampere DC power supply to IC input pin and also fix aluminum heat sink to IC for controlling heat when giving maximum current.

With given resistor and capacitor values, bulb flashes around 4 times per second and flashing speed depends on capacitor charge and discharge time.

Hence, by changing resistor and capacitor values, we can adjust flashing beacon flash speed for different requirements..

Timing Period Calculation:

Time for light to turn ON and OFF (called period T) depends on RC time constant and resistor and capacitor together with LM317 decide this timing.

We can imagine or calculate the time period T for blinking using this simple formula for astable circuit with LM317:

T = 1.1 × R × C

where,

To make light blink how we want, choose voltage for lamp (VL) and capacitor voltage (VC).

Example: we want bulb blink every 2 seconds.

Lets say we use capacitor C = 10µF (that is 0.00001 F)

Then use formula:

R = T​ / 1.1 × C = 2​ / 1.1 × 0.00001 = 18.18k

To make close to that, we can join three 10k resistors in series and if want more accurate blink time, change resistor value a little.

By using these simple steps and parts we already have, we can build working flashing beacon light, but just adjust resistor and capacitor value until timing and blinking work how one needs.
